Governor's Generosity Declined in Favour of Charity
Pastor Paul Enenche, the founder and senior pastor of Dunamis International Gospel Centre, Abuja, has rejected a ₦30 million cash gift from Kebbi State Governor, Nasir Idris. The gift was offered during a healing and deliverance crusade held at the Haliru Abdu Stadium in Birnin Kebbi. Pastor Enenche's decision has sparked widespread admiration and conversations across social media.
According to reports, the governor's representative announced the donation to support the crusade, stating that the ₦30 million was available in cash and ready to be handed over. However, Pastor Enenche politely declined the gift, suggesting that the funds be redirected to orphanages or other charitable causes.
